What Ecosystem Services Do Forests Provide?

Forests are not just collections of trees; they are complex ecosystems bursting with life and functionality, contributing immensely to the health of our planet. The services they provide can be categorized into four main types: provisioning, regulating, supporting, and cultural. Each of these categories sheds light on another facet of how forests benefit us, from tangible resources like timber and food to crucial processes such as climate regulation, soil protection, and recreation. Grasping the depth of these services helps appreciate the integral role forests play in our lives and the broader biosphere.

Provisioning Services

When thinking about what forests offer, the first things that often come to mind are the tangible products. Provisioning services include the myriad of resources that forests provide, such as timber, fruits, nuts, and medicinal plants. People from various cultures have, for centuries, relied on forests for their livelihoods. Wood from forests serves as a primary material for construction and furniture and also acts as a vital energy source in many developing regions. Beyond timber, forests produce fruit and nuts that feed communities and contribute to local economies. Medicinal plants found in these lush landscapes have led to the discovery of numerous essential pharmaceuticals, highlighting how forests directly impact human health and well-being.

Regulating Services

Regulating services are particularly nuanced yet immensely significant in the fight against climate change. Forests help regulate the climate by sequestering carbon dioxide, thereby mitigating greenhouse gas emissions. They act as natural buffers against extreme weather events by absorbing rainwater and reducing the risk of floods, an increasingly important function as climate variability intensifies. Additionally, forests filter pollutants from the air and water, improving the overall environment we live in. The biodiversity within forests plays a vital role in soil formation and prevents soil erosion. This stabilization of the soil prevents landslides and protects water bodies from sedimentation, making forests essential for maintaining healthy ecosystems.

Supporting Services

Supporting services might not be immediately visible, but they form the backbone of forest ecosystems. Forests enhance soil fertility through leaf litter decomposition, providing a nutrient-rich foundation for plant and animal life. This symbiotic relationship among organisms promotes a healthy ecosystem where species thrive, each playing a specific role in maintaining balance. Pollination of plants, which is crucial for food production, is facilitated by forest-dwelling species, showcasing another layer of interconnected services. Furthermore, forests serve as habitats for countless species, promoting biodiversity and ensuring diverse gene pools that are essential for resilience against diseases and environmental changes.

Cultural Services

Forests have profound cultural significance, influencing traditions, spiritual practices, and recreational activities. They often serve as destinations for hiking, camping, and wildlife observation, fostering a connection between humans and nature that is crucial for mental well-being. Many communities hold forests sacred and view them as integral to their cultural heritage. The aesthetic beauty of forests inspires literature, art, and folklore, enriching human culture and reinforcing our emotional tie to nature. This connection emphasizes the need for conservation, not just for ecological reasons, but also to preserve the cultural identity tied to these magnificent landscapes.

The Importance of Biodiversity

Forest ecosystems are home to an extraordinary variety of flora and fauna. This biodiversity is not just a fascinating aspect of forests; it is critical for their resilience and the suite of services they can offer. Diverse ecosystems are better equipped to withstand disturbances, whether natural or human-made. The presence of various species ensures that if one is affected, others may continue to provide essential services. This stability is particularly important in a changing climate, where flexible and diverse systems are more likely to adapt and survive. Thus, recognizing the significance of biodiversity is fundamental to understanding the overall productivity and health of forest ecosystems.

The Role of Forests in Water Cycle Regulation

Forests play a crucial role in regulating the water cycle, affecting both local and global scales. They help maintain groundwater levels and contribute to the hydrological cycle by transpiring water back into the atmosphere. This process ultimately affects rainfall patterns, enhancing the moisture in the air and impacting weather systems. Forests also help filter and purify water, stabilizing streams and rivers by reducing erosion and providing natural habitats for aquatic life. Healthy forests lead to cleaner water resources, which is vital not only for human consumption but also for the myriad organisms that rely on these water systems.

Forest Conservation and Its Impact

Despite the essential services provided by forests, deforestation and degradation threaten their existence. Urbanization, agriculture, and logging have led to significant loss of forest cover, negatively impacting the ecosystem services they provide. Conservation efforts are not just about preserving trees; they are about maintaining the myriad connections that forests foster among species, the climate, and human cultures. Practices like sustainable forestry, reforestation, and the establishment of protected areas are essential strategies for conserving forest ecosystems. Everyone has a role to play, from companies prioritizing sustainable practices to individuals supporting conservation initiatives in their communities.

Forests and Climate Change Mitigation

As we grapple with the pressing issue of climate change, forests emerge as vital allies in the fight. They act as carbon sinks, absorbing huge quantities of CO2 from the atmosphere and helping mitigate global warming. Protecting existing forests and restoring degraded lands can significantly reduce greenhouse gas emissions while enhancing biodiversity and ecological health. Moreover, promoting agroforestry, where crops and trees grow together, can offer dual benefits of food production and carbon sequestration, blending agricultural needs with environmental stewardship. Thus, forests serve both as a solution to climate challenges and as a means of securing our future.
